Job description

The Residential Designer will contribute to all stages of project development, working with consultants in completing various project deliverables. The responsibilities will include conception, design-to-fit customer needs, and team collaboration.

Essential Functions

  • Creation, design, and execution of projects in Concept Design, Schematic Design, Design Development and tender packages.
  • Development of innovative and functional design solutions and processes.
  • Identify specific needs on architectural guidelines for new subdivisions.
  • Design new homes, new elevations and site plans.
  • Coordination with Purchasing and Marketing departments.
  • Release drawings to Purchasing department.
  • Support the Marketing department in preparation of marketing materials.
  • Contribute to the review of the drawing packages for accuracy, design integrity and code compliance.
  • Organize and present new ideas to stakeholders.
  • Quantity take offs and estimating as required.
  • Performs other related duties as assigned.
